As a many of you know, I am a musician and lead guitar player for my band, "The Bad Influence Garage Band". We play mostly blues tunes.

Well, I had the opportunity to get a guitar made for me, and had the money, $5,500 bones. I got it yesterday and let it sit overnight to acclimate to the current conditions. It's an Les Paul Memphis ES, hand wired pickups, Orange Drop capacitor's, semi-hollowbody, f-hole with soul. It is sort of a cross between a regular Les Paul and with elements from a Les Paul 335.
